Abstract (EN)

The most important aspects of diagnosing a disease are determining its cause and then attempting to find a treatment. Pterygium is a disorder that isn't completely understood yet and it's described as a growth disorder by some and a degenerative disorder by others. However, several studies have been conducted in this field, and certain factors for this disease have been identified, including UV, virus, growth factors, apoptosis, ECM, MMP, and interleukins. Uncontrolled proliferation of conjunctiva cells onto the cornea, metaplasia, and certain reports of malignant traits have been documented. Furthermore, the ARPC-2 gene has been discovered to play a role in the progression and induction of a certain type of cancer, which is one of the Arp 2/3 complex's subunits that is involved in actin assembly and therefore sustains and maintains cellular integrity, the objective of this paper is to determine how ARPC-2 gene expression relates to pterygium development and formation. The quantitative reverse transcription PCR method was used to determine the rate of gene expression in 18 samples with pterygium and 18 normal conjunctiva of the same eye. The gathered data showed that the expression of ARPC-2 in pterygium has up-regulated (3.24±1,75) compared to normal conjunctiva, although there was not a significant difference between the two groups (p = 0.209). In conclusion the up-regulation of ARPC-2 gene is thought that it may contribute to pterygium development and formation.
